  • Patent number: 6450815
    Abstract: The present invention elated to a dental prosthetics and more particularly to an improved support post having a centrally convergent shank portion for securing a dental prosthesis, such as an artificial crown, to the root of a tooth. The invention further relates to a method and a device for strengthening a tooth and a root from which the nerve has been removed and specifically to a dental post which provides centering for the forming of a bracing filler to internally reinforce the walls of pulpless roots while providing for the support of an artificial prosthesis. The invention further provides for a secondary reinforcing device surrounding the central dental post and also being capable of following the contours of the tooth root. This secondary strengthening and reinforcing element is a flexibly coiled wire of a generally helicoid shape, which also serves as a matrix for the luting of composite filler.

  • Patent number: 5888514
    Abstract: A composition for treating a mammal having a condition characterized by bone or joint inflammation comprises:2,250 mg soluble bovine cartilage,250 mg soluble shark cartilage,1,000 mg glucosamine sulfate,350 mg mucopolysaccharide concentrate,225 mg proteolytic enzymes from hog pancreatic extract,500 mg standardized extract of ashwagandha,470 mg extract of Boswellia serrata comprising 150 mg boswellic acid1,000 mg chondroitin polysulfate,100 mg extract of sea cucumber,300 mg black currant seed oil,3,500 mg ascorbic acid (vitamin C),150 mg pyridoxine HCl (vitamin B6),1,000 mg devil's claw powder.
